Lady's "1st Birthday Paw-ty"

Last month, we celebrated Lady's first birthday. I've never thrown a party for a dog before, but it was a great excuse to invite my Las Vegas grandchildren over for cake!


I made most of the decorations on my Silhouette Cameo, but a few things - like the backdrop and the balloons - came from Amazon. 

I bought the picture frame, dog bowls, and tableware from the dollar store, of course! I got the small wooden fire hydrant and dog house from a craft supply website, then painted/glittered them. The "dog bones," actually "Scooby Doo" graham crackers, were a big hit.

I cut a piece off of the backdrop to make a table runner (using packaging tape to "hem" the raw edges). I made the ribbon garland with a thin piece of rope, and a few spools of coordinating ribbon. It was a time-consuming task, but easy to do while watching some of my favorite guilty pleasures on Netflix.

My favorite bakery was unable to make the cake, so I had to do it myself. This tutorial made it easy, but it was still very time-consuming: Yorkie Dog Cake Recipe - BettyCrocker.com  I couldn't find hot pink cake board foil, so I used wrapping paper (but if you do this, be sure to have an extra cake board under the cake, so the icing doesn't stain the paper). I used fondant to cover an ice cream cone for the hat, and to cover a waffle cone bowl for the dog bowl (then I used edible glitter on each). The "dog food" is cocoa puffs. The bone was also made of fondant, cut with a cookie cutter.


I ordered the puppies from Amazon. They're keychains, which were more cost-effective - I just cut off the attached key rings.
